Juicy Grilled Chicken Thighs
The best and juiciest grilled chicken thighs you'll ever make, with a marinade of homemade dry rub and liquid smoke. The chicken thighs are so moist and delicious!

- 1 1/2 lbs (750g) bone in chicken thighs (5 small thighs)
- 2 1/2 tablespoons homemade dry rub
- 1/2 tablespoon liquid smoke
- 1 tablespoon olive oil for grilling
Score the bottom part of the chicken thighs lengthwise with a few slits. This will make sure that the marinade ingredients get inside the chicken meat.
Marinate the chicken thighs with homemade dry rub and liquid smoke. Stir to combine well.
Grill the chicken thighs on direct heat at 300°F (150°C), about 2 minutes on each side, with the skin side down first. Turn the chicken thighs a couple of times to avoid burning. Baste the chicken with olive oil while grilling.
Move the chicken thighs to the side of the grill without direct heat and barbeque the chicken. Cover the gas grill and continue to barbeque the chicken thighs for about 6-8 minutes. The hot air in the grill will BBQ and cook the chicken and will retain the juice.
The grilling time depends on the size of the thighs, but the internal temperature should be 165°F (75°C) when it's completely cooked through. Serve hot with your favorite hot sauce.
